My 7-y-o ds has been on a clear liquid elimination diet for 6 days. He is discouraged because he wants to eat, but he gets tummy aches after practically every "meal" and he has difficulty swallowing. He wants to eat more, but his tummy needs to heal. :(

We just finished unit 6 of Bigger yesterday. We had been singing the last verse of Oh For A Thousand Tongues as a prayer for Grandma all week. She's in a wheelchair. Well, yesterday, we read Joni Erickson Tada's testimony about how she rejoices that one day she will leap for joy in a new and perfect body. Ds's eyes got really big to hear about Joni, who can't use her arms & legs, but still trusts God. I could see the wheels turning in his mind.

Prior discussions about being changed when Christ comes have made ds afraid. But now he said, you mean I won't get stomach aches any more? We will be able to eat anything then?

He smiled & sang the whole song through with me, even though he was lying on the couch under a blanket with his knees curled up around his aching tummy.

Perfectly timed and perfectly comprehended through the Holy Spirit. Thank you, Carrie for letting God use you to speak truth into ds's life!
